- Wading - Definition, Meaning Synonyms | Vocabulary. com
Wading is the act of walking in shallow water If you forget your bathing suit when you go to the lake, wading is a fun way to spend the day You can think of wading as a low-commitment alternative to swimming, since it doesn't require special gear and you won't even get your hair wet
